The JF Banumathi font is a popular non-Unicode Tamil font often used in publishing and graphic design. The "portable" feature typically refers to its integration with portable language software like Azhagi+ or Azhagi++, which allow you to use the font across different Windows applications without a complex system-wide installation. Key Features of JF Banumathi

Typeface Style: It is a modulated "serif-style" Tamil font, similar in aesthetic to traditional print media and often used for formal documents or titles.

Encoding: As a non-Unicode font, it often requires specific keyboard drivers or transliteration tools to map English keystrokes to Tamil characters correctly. Portable Integration:

No Permanent Installation: When used with portable versions of software like Azhagi++ (Version 6), you can carry the font and the typing tool on a USB drive and use it on any guest computer.

Hot-key Support: Users can often toggle the font's input mode using a simple hotkey (like Alt+0 or Alt+F6) within applications like MS Word.

Compatibility: While primarily designed for Windows, modern font viewers and third-party apps like the Vanavil Bamini Font Viewer for Android allow users to view texts in similar legacy font formats on mobile devices.

The "Portable" aspect of JF Banumathi is particularly useful for users working in environments where they lack administrative rights to install new fonts or frequently switch between workstations.

No Installation Required: Portable fonts can often be loaded temporarily into the system's memory using font management tools or by simply keeping the file on a USB drive.
